Fix — Xentryapi.dll

The Role of XentryAPI.dll in Mercedes-Benz Diagnostics XentryAPI.dll

3. Actuator Testing (Output Tests)

  1. Restore from quarantine: Check your antivirus software (particularly McAfee, Norton, or Windows Defender) and restore the file.
  2. Re-register the DLL: Open Command Prompt as Administrator and run:
    regsvr32 xentryapi.dll
    
    (Note: This only works if the file is in the system path.)
  3. Repair XENTRY installation: Run the XENTRY installer and select "Repair". This will replace missing or corrupted DLLs.
  1. Corrupted or Damaged Files: Corruption or damage to the xentryapi.dll file can cause errors or prevent the file from loading properly.
  2. Incorrect Registry Entries: Invalid or incorrect registry entries can prevent the xentryapi.dll file from being registered properly, leading to errors.
  3. Xentry Software Issues: Problems with the Xentry software installation or configuration can cause xentryapi.dll errors.
  4. Windows Registry Issues: Issues with the Windows registry, such as corrupted or missing entries, can cause xentryapi.dll errors.

Solutions:

Error 1: "xentryapi.dll not found"

D-PDU API

Modern versions of XENTRY rely on the (Diagnostic Protocol Data Unit API) standard (ISO 22900-2). xentryapi.dll acts as a wrapper that converts XENTRY’s proprietary commands into D-PDU compliant requests. This allows XENTRY to support a wide range of third-party vehicles communication interfaces (VCIs), provided they have a compliant D-PDU driver. xentryapi.dll

1. Flashing (Programming) Control Units